You're basically talking about a turbine. It's not powered by smoke, so much as the rising of hot air. And I think a steam turbine would be more efficient than one powered by hot air. Steam turbines are what almost all of the modern day power plants use - the variety is in how you heat the water to steam. Nuclear, coal, concentrated solar power, geothermal - they all generate heat that turns water into steam, which rises through turbines to generate power. In a closed system, you'd then run the steam through condensers, to go back into the liquid supply.
